Burnley manager Eddie Howe is reportedly hoping to replace Jay Rodriguez with Wolverhampton Wanderers forward Sam Vokes.

Burnley are believed to be planning a bid for Wolverhampton Wanderers forward Sam Vokes.

The 22-year-old spent two months on loan with the Championship club last season and had previously worked with Clarets boss Eddie Howe at Bournemouth.

Howe is a long-term admirer of Vokes and he is willing to spend the majority of the reported £7m transfer fee from the sale of Jay Rodriguez to bring him to Turf Moor, according to The Sun.

Vokes, who joined Wolves in 2008, has only made four league starts for the Molineux outfit.
